The General Format 

The PTE test pattern remains unchanged, regardless of country.

  • Listening: The section stretches from 45 to 57 minutes. Candidates are required to listen to audio and complete 8 question types. 
  • Reading: You will have about 30 minutes to finish 5 parts of the section. 
  • Speaking And Writing: This section takes up most of the time of the PTE test, from 54 to 67 minutes. You will have to complete 8 question types, including the unscored personal introduction.

The Test Eligibility

The Canadian PTE test is open to all students and employees worldwide who want to study and reside in Canada regardless of their religion, sex, and skin color.

Like the PTE Academic in general, the PTE for Canada is only accessible to candidates aged 16 years old or more. 

If you are between 16 and 18, your parents or guardians must sign a parental consent form. This form means that your adults approve of your test-taking.  

The Scoring

The overall PTE score falls between 10 to 90, and the higher marks mean better levels. 

The report will be updated after 5 business days. During this time, you should frequently check your email so you don’t miss any instruction emails. Follow those guidelines, and you can check your final score.

The Minimum PTE Score For Canadian Universities In 2024 

There is no exact minimum PTE score. It depends on your purposes, like pursuing PTE immigration Canada or pursuing diploma courses in Canadian universities. For example: 

  • Diploma: You need at least a 45 score.
  • Undergraduate degree: The minimum PTE for most degrees is 50.
  • Postgraduate qualification: A PTE result of at least 65 is required.
  • Advanced courses (Law, Medicine, Psychology, etc.): With a higher level of difficulty, you will need from 60-70 or even more.

Top 10 PTE-Accepted Universities In Canada

Is PTE essential? Yes, if you want to apply to any of the universities listed below.

University Minimum PTE Score
University Of British Columbia 65 (no skills below 60)
University Of Alberta 61
University of Waterloo 63 (at least 65 in writing and speaking)
York University 65
McMaster University 60 (at least 60 in writing and speaking)
Queen’s University 60
University of Ottawa 60
Concordia University 61 (no skills below 53)
University of Guelph 60
University of Manitoba 45
